Output 68f4e9901c8a3985425ad5b633d0a17ea4d9ed12ef3f90d49c65691977097f1b:0

value
632626249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ed56af19f64bd18d4dbf387b00394ece5fe25de8 OP_EQUAL
address
MVY6DoYEUgPg6quNLp2UgfwNw5iaUKxfQ7
transaction
68f4e9901c8a3985425ad5b633d0a17ea4d9ed12ef3f90d49c65691977097f1b
spent
true